State adds 122 new COVID; Big Isle adds 21

The State of Hawaii has confirmed 122 new COVID-19 cases today, the third day in a row there were 100 or more new cases (yesterday, 100, and Wednesday, 156).  The state’s new cumulative total is 15,691.

O’ahu has 87 new cases, there are 6 new cases on Maui Island and 6 in residents who are out of state, and there is one new case on each Kaua’i and Lanai.

Hawaii Island again added the second most cases, at 21.  The Big Island’s total is 1,375, with 67 people having required hospitalization and 48 people having died (though the State is only reporting 31 so far).  The active case number on the Big Island is 356.

Hilo Medical Center reports 5 people with COVID-19 in the hospital’s COVID-19 Unit, and 1 person with COVID-19 in the Intensive Care Unit, separated from other patients, and not on a ventilator.  Kona Community Hospital has 6 patients with COVID-19, with 2 in the ICU and one of those on a ventilator, and the other 4 in the hospital’s COVID-19 area.
